Abstract
We report an unusual case of a 29-year-old female with a short duration of right lower eyelid swelling, painful eye movement and paraesthesia of right cheek. She was subsequently worked up with mucormycosis in mind, but intra-operative findings were suggestive of an infected Haller cell and post-operatively she was symptom free.
